video review : The Garbage Pail Kids Movie

You don’t have to collect the trading cards to be entertained by this Movie. You need only strengthen your stomach and open your mind wide enough to dump yourself into its campy charm. It’s about a group of Kids “blessed with unusual features”.

There’s a girl who Vomits, a girl with a snotty nose, a boy who farts, a Nerd with acne who can’t hold his bladder, a 1950s-style tough guy, a Mommyless baby with bad breath and an Ali Gator with a toe fetish. Flaws and all, they’re a likeable bunch.

They’re conjured from a Garbage Pail to the “normie” world at an old antique shop ran by a philosophical magician after the boy who works there tips it over by mistake during a scuffle with the local bullies, one of which he has a romantic crush on.

The baby with the bad breath provides the funniest parts; namely the Binaca spray and movie theater slap scenes. Another standout is the Working song the Kids sing about a third in. I wish there were more. The Movie would work better as a musical.

video review : Dawn Of The Dead

Night Of The Living Dead is a horror classic. Dawn, the title of which suggests it takes place the following morning; if the background calendars are up to date, it’s actually over a decade later; is a mess.

This, in comparison to the original, is easily the worst movie sequel I’ve ever seen. The narrative degradation from a serious thriller to what at times seems like wacky slapstick is staggeringly disappointing.

That the ghoul-shooting protagonists are no longer confined to a small house; most of this story takes place in an “indoor” shopping mall; is part of the problem. The rest has to do with the deadpan plot.

Great Value Ice Cream [ Holiday ] : Frozen Hot Chocolate

This ice cream isn’t regular chocolate labeled Hot Chocolate to make more people buy it. It really tastes like hot chocolate, cocoa rather, especially when melted down to gooey lumps as I do when eating ice cream at home.

What rich and delicious hot cocoa it is. A lot of that has to do with the inclusion of caramel, which adds an extra winter-boot-kick of sweetness. There’s also a marshmallow swirl and chocolate chunks added to the mix.
